PZ-38. SECOND READING ORDINANCE - (J-87-903)
ZONING TEXT AMD
APPLICANTS) Planning Dept
PETITION : Amendment "U"
Ord 9500 text amendment by amending ARTICLE 20
GENERAL AND SUPPLEMENTARY REGULATIONS, Section
2003 Accessory Uses and Structures, Subsection
2003.6 Permanent Active Recreation Facilities
as accessory uses in residential districts;
special permits, by restating the subsection
to require a Class C Special Permit for RS-1,
RS-2 and RG-1 districts and special exception
approval for the RG-2 and more liberal
districts, if these active recreation
facilities are located adjacent to streets
and/or where they exceed 20 percent of net,
not gross lot area; by amending Section 2005
General terms defined; related limitations,
Subsection 2005.1 Lot, defined, prohibition
against divisions creating substandard lots,
by deleting the existing definition and
inserting in lieu thereof a tot definition
identical with Chapter 54.5-1 Subdivision
Regulations of the City Code, and referencing
that Chapter; by amending the Schedule of
District Regulations, page 1 of 6, Uses and
Structures, Accessory Uses and Structures, RS-
1; RS-2 One Family Detached Residential, under
Permissible Only by Special Permit, paragraph
2, by deleting parenthesis (a) which had
required a Class C Special Permit for active
recreation facilities even if not located
adjacent to streets or even if less than 20
percent of gross tot area, by renumbering
parenthesis, and by substituting a Class C
Special Permit rather than a special exception
for active recreation facilities adjacent to
streets and greater than 20 percent of net,
not gross lot area; and by amending the
Schedule of District Regulations, page 3 of 6,
Uses and Structures, Accessory Uses and
Structures, for both RO-3, RO-4 Residential -
Office and 0-I Office -Institutional under uses
permitted generally or permissible by special
permit, paragraph 1, to change an erroneous
reference from "Section 20203.7" to "Section
2003.7".
Planning Department Recommends : APPROVAL
Planning Advisory Board Recommends : APPROVAL, 9-0

PART 8
2:00 PM CONSENT AGENDA
Unless a member of the City Commission wishes to remove
a specific item from this portion of the agenda, Items 1
through 9 constitute the Consent Agenda. These
resolutions are self-explanatory and are not expected to
require additional review or discussion. Each item will
be recorded as individually numbered resolutions,
adopted unanimously by the following motion:
"...that the Consent Agenda comprised of items 1
through 9 Be —adopted..."
The Mayor or City Clerk shall state the following:
"Before the vote on adopting items included in the
Consent Agenda is taken, is there anyone present who is
an objector or proponent that wishes to speak on any
item in the Consent Agenda? Hearing none, the vote on
the adoption of the Consent Agenda will now be taken."
